From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48 [gcide]:

  Detrain \De*train"\, v. i. & t.
     To alight, or to cause to alight, from a railway train.
     [Eng.] --London Graphic.
     [1913 Webster]

From WordNet (r) 2.0 [wn]:



  detrain
       v : leave a train
